Hawai'i mirrorplant
Scientific Name: Coprosma cymosa
Family: Rubiaceae
Category: Dicot
Growth: Vine, Shrub
Duration: Perennial

Distribution and Habitat
- Native to Hawai'i (the Big Island and East Maui), where it thrives in mesic forests at elevations ranging from 1830 to 3050 meters.
